发明名称 ROTOR FOR ROTATING ELECTRIC MACHINE
摘要 PROBLEM TO BE SOLVED: To reduce deformation and vibration in claw-shaped magnetic poles in a rotor. SOLUTION: The rotor for rotating electric machine comprises rotor coils 15 for generating magnetic flux, pole cores provided so that the rotor coils 15 are covered therewith and comprising first pole core bodies 19 and second pole core bodies 20 each having claw-shaped magnetic poles 21 and 22 protruded so that they are alternately engaged with each other, magnets 23 which are placed on both side faces of the claw-shaped magnetic poles 21 and 22 and reduce the leakage of magnet flux between the side faces of adjacent claw-shaped magnetic poles 21 and 22, and magnet assemblies 25 comprising magnet holding members 24 which support the magnets 23 on the claw-shaped magnetic poles 21 and 22. The magnet assemblies 25 are so disposed that, when the magnet assemblies 25 are installed on the claw-shaped magnetic poles 21 and 22, the center 25G of each magnet assembly 25 is positioned at the base of the claw-shaped magnetic poles 21 and 22.
